Why we love this

Kalmus Edition collections have long served as reliable sources for serious flute study, and Book III deepens the work begun in earlier volumes. This resource focuses on masterwork excerpts, giving students direct access to the passages that matter most in professional and advanced amateur contexts.

What to expect

Moving through masterwork excerpts creates a sense of musical maturity and connection to the flute's central role in orchestral and chamber music traditions. Each passage demands both technical precision and interpretive awareness, rewarding careful, thoughtful preparation.

Who it's for

Advanced flute students preparing for auditions, college ensemble placements, or professional orchestra repertoire study. Teachers seeking curated excerpts from the standard flute canon will find this volume essential for focused repertoire preparation.

How to get the most out of it

  • Work through each excerpt systematically rather than jumping around. The progression across the book builds both technical and musical sophistication.
  • Use the Kalmus edition text as your primary source, then compare with full scores when available to understand harmonic context and orchestral balance.
  • Practice each excerpt at multiple tempos, including slower speeds for intonation control before working toward performance tempo.

How to use it

Assign excerpts strategically throughout the school year, pairing them with full-length pieces your ensemble is performing to deepen individual understanding of context and style. These materials work particularly well in studio settings where preparing for ensemble auditions or solo recitals is part of the curriculum.

Skills your students will build

  • Navigating varied orchestral excerpts across different musical styles and periods
  • Sight-reading fluency with masterwork passages at advanced difficulty levels
  • Intonation control in exposed ensemble situations
  • Stylistic interpretation grounded in standard repertoire expectations
  • Technical facility with passages demanding extended range and articulation precision
